What is Mesh wi-Fi?

Before ⁤diving⁣ into‍ optimization tips, let’s clarify what mesh Wi-Fi is. Unlike⁣ conventional routers, ​which broadcast signals from a ⁤single point, mesh Wi-fi​ systems⁢ use multiple interconnected devices ⁢(nodes) that ‍work together to create a strong, seamless network. This ⁣setup considerably reduces⁢ dead zones and provides better coverage ⁤in larger homes.

Proven Tips ⁢to Enhance Your⁤ Mesh​ Wi-Fi Stability

Now that ⁢we ⁤understand mesh⁤ wi-Fi systems,let’s ⁢explore practical tips to ensure your network operates at ⁤its best:

1. Optimal Node Placement

One ⁤of the most critical​ factors for⁣ mesh Wi-Fi stability is ‍the placement of nodes.‌ Here are some tips:

  • Place your primary ‍node near ‍the center of your home.
  • Avoid placing ‌nodes near walls‌ or large objects that‍ can obstruct signals.
  • Ensure nodes are within‍ range of one another; a distance ⁢of about 30‍ feet is generally‍ recommended.

2. Use a ⁣Wired Backhaul Connection

If possible,connect⁣ nodes⁣ using ethernet cables.This wired backhaul method enhances stability and ⁣speed by reducing the strain on your Wi-Fi‌ signal.

3. Regular ​Software Updates

keep your mesh system updated.‍ Manufacturers regularly release firmware updates to improve performance‌ and security:

  • Check for updates via the​ manufacturer’s app‌ or⁤ website.
  • Enable automatic updates if ‍available.

4.‍ Reduce Interference

Many⁢ household ⁤devices can interfere⁣ with⁤ Wi-fi signals. Here’s how to minimize this ​interference:

  • Keep your mesh nodes away from microwaves,cordless phones,and bluetooth devices.
  • Use ‌the ⁣5GHz ⁤band for devices‍ that require higher speeds, as it usually experiences less interference.

5. ‌Optimize Network Settings

Adjusting your network⁤ settings ‍can ⁤also vastly improve stability:

  • Change the Wi-Fi channel‍ within your router settings to a less congested channel.
  • Enable Quality of service (QoS) settings to prioritize⁢ traffic for critical devices.

6. Monitor Network Performance

Keep an eye on your network’s performance‌ using applications like NetSpot or‍ wi-Fi Analyzer. These tools help you identify weak spots and suggest improvements.

7.​ Limit Connected Devices

More devices ⁣can lead⁢ to slower speeds.​ If you’re experiencing issues, consider:

  • Disconnecting unused devices.
  • Using ⁤device limits ​on ⁤your mesh system to⁤ manage bandwidth usage.

Advanced Techniques for⁢ Mesh ⁢Wi-Fi Optimization

While the above-mentioned ​tips are crucial for improving your⁢ mesh Wi-Fi experience,there​ are also advanced methods you‌ can employ to optimize ⁢your network ⁣even further:

8. Implement Network Segmentation

Network segmentation ‌allows you⁢ to create separate ⁣networks for different‌ purposes. For‌ example, you‍ could‍ have one network for smart ⁤home⁣ devices and another for personal devices. This reduces load⁣ on the main network‌ and can lead to better performance. Here’s how you can do⁢ it:

  • Use your mesh system’s ​app to ‍create guest networks for visitors.
  • Assign specific devices, ‍like gaming ​consoles or IoT devices, to their ⁢designated networks.

9. ⁢Utilize​ Mesh Features

Many modern mesh systems come equipped with features designed to‍ enhance stability. Make sure to leverage these functionalities:

  • Enable band steering ​to automatically connect⁤ devices to the best ⁤frequency band available.
  • Explore‍ built-in parental controls to manage device ⁤usage, ⁤which can help alleviate network congestion.

10. Conduct a ⁤Site Survey

Conducting a site survey ⁣is an effective way to identify problematic areas ⁤in your home. ‌Here are steps to‌ follow:

  • Walk around your ⁣home with a Wi-Fi analyzer ⁣app to⁢ check signal strength ⁤and‍ identify weak spots.
  • Take⁣ note of⁣ areas ‍with low coverage and ⁢consider⁣ adding additional ‍nodes or repositioning existing ones.

common Mesh Wi-Fi Myths Debunked

As with any technology, several myths surround mesh Wi-Fi systems. It’s critical to separate fact⁤ from fiction⁤ to ⁢optimize your experience:

Myth 1: ​More Nodes Always ‌Mean Better Performance

While ⁢adding more nodes ‌can ‍enhance coverage,⁢ adding too⁢ many can lead to interference issues.Focus on the quality of ⁣placement rather‍ than quantity.

myth 2: Mesh Wi-Fi Works Well Everywhere

mesh systems may struggle in‍ homes with‌ particularly thick walls or metal ⁢construction. Evaluate your home’s‌ layout and materials before investing in a mesh system.

Myth 3: All ⁢Mesh ​Systems ‌Are the Same

Not ‍all mesh ‍systems ‌provide the same ⁢performance.Research ​different brands and models to find one that fits your ⁢needs, particularly ​in​ terms of range, ⁢speed, and features.
